[0033] figure 1 It is a schematic diagram of the structure of the single-point displacement meter provided by the present invention, such as figure 1 As shown, it includes: a sensor 1, a data reading disc 2, a flange 3, a single-point settlement gauge body 4, an elongated measuring rod 5, and an anchoring head 6.
